On 01.05.2017 15:46, Torsten Schoenfeld wrote: > Until the issue is fixed in gtk+, we could use overrides in Gtk3 to hide > the problem. With the helper functions I just added to G:O:I*, this can > be done with the attached patch. The problem is that this would change > the semantics of Gtk3::Widget::get_events: it would now return a > Glib::Flags object instead of a raw integer. Since Glib::Flags > currently does not support raw integers, comparisons like > $widget->get_events == 0 would now fail. (The corresponding tests in > the patch fail.)
